Russian Ambitions, Ctd

Russia is doing what it can in the clandestine war waged by the United States and Saudi Arabia.  Dalan McEndree of WorldPress.org reports on how Russia is attacking the OPEC oil alliance:

Putin’s moves also are strengthening Russia’s influence with OPEC. Russia already has extensive and close ties with Iran and Venezuela, and is now laying the basis for such ties with Iraq. Putin has aligned Russia with OPEC’s have-nots—the members lacking the financial resources to withstand low crude prices for an extended period and that have objected to Saudi policies (Iran, Iraq, Angola, Nigeria, Libya, Algeria, Ecuador and Venezuela)—against the haves (Saudi Arabia, Kuwait, the UAE and Qatar). He has continually supported Venezuelan President Nicolás Maduro’s calls for an emergency OPEC meeting on prices and his efforts to persuade Saudi Arabia to reverse its policy. At the beginning of September, Putin told Maduro that the two countries “must team up to shore up oil prices.”

In addition, Russia’s deputy prime minister in charge of energy policy, Arkady Dvorkovich, made comments that mocked Saudi policy, saying that “OPEC producers are suffering the ricochet effects of their attempt to flush out rivals by flooding the world with excess output,” expressing doubt that OPEC members “really want to live with low oil prices for a long time,” and implying that Saudi policy is irrational.

Indeed, Russia can be seen as maneuvering to split OPEC into two blocs, with Russia, although not a member, persuading the “Russian bloc” to isolate Saudi Arabia and the Gulf Arab OPEC members within OPEC. This might persuade the Saudis to seek a compromise with the have-nots.

A strategic alliance with Iran and Iraq offers Putin two more potential avenues by which to pressure the Saudis. They can test Saudi determination to defend their market share at any price and its financial wherewithal to do so. Iran claims it can raise crude output by 1 million barrels within six or so months of the lifting of sanctions. The Saudis may be calculating that Iran must first rehabilitate its oil fields and that Iran, cash poor, cannot do so quickly. If this is the case, Russia could step in, offer Iran financing, and force the Saudis to contemplate prices staying lower longer than they anticipated and therefore continuing pressure on their economy.

He also addresses the Chinese market:

Russia also could cooperate with Iran and Iraq to take market share from Saudi Arabia in the vital Chinese market. As a recent Bloomberg article pointed out, Saudi Arabia, Iran, Russia, Iraq and other countries are vying intensely for sales to China, the second-largest import market and the major source of demand growth in coming years. Coordinating their pricing and consistently offering the Chinese prices below the Saudi price, they could seek to win market share. Such a price war would pressure the competitors’ currencies.

Corporate Cheating of Customers

Continuing the theme under a new name, Michael Graham Richard @ Treehugger.com believes he may have found evidence of another scandal, much like the VW scam:

Samsung likes to brag about its ‘smart’ televisions. Well, maybe they’re a little too smart for their own good. Drawing an uncomfortable parallel with Volkswagen’s emission rigging scheme, the European Commission is now investigating the South-Korean company to figure out whether its televisions’ are designed to modify their power consumption when they detect that they are being tested for energy efficiency. This alleged fraud has been uncovered by independent labs, once again.

From his source at the guardian:

The European commission says it will investigate any allegations of cheating the tests and has pledged to tighten energy efficiency regulations to outlaw the use of so-called “defeat devices” in TVs or other consumer products, after several EU states raised similar concerns.

Which sounds very upright, doesn’t it?  Outlawing defeat devices, that is.  Except we’re really talking consumer fraud here, and so there’s a law already in place to cover the situation.

But as an engineer, my question is this: why are the test engineers disclosing their test environment to the development engineers?  That’s madness barely understandable, and I do mean barely.  Additionally, the testing should cover a very wide range of conditions in order to understand the behavior of the device as conditions change – it’s close to insanity to suggest that recognition of a test environment is even possible for responsible testing.

At this point, it’s really on the test engineers to explain how the device manufacturers can possibly discern the difference between real environments and test environments, and why their test environments should be detectable.

Preserving Extinct Mammal Colors

Newswise reports that melanin is retained during fossilization of mammals:

“We have now studied the tissues from fish, frogs, and tadpoles, hair from mammals, feathers from birds, and ink from octopus and squids,” said Caitlin Colleary, a doctoral student of geosciences in the College of Science at Virginia Tech and lead author of the study. “They all preserve melanin, so it’s safe to say that melanin is really all over the place in the fossil record. Now we can confidently fill in some of the original color patterns of these ancient animals.” …

The researchers said microscopic structures traditionally believed to be fossilized bacteria are in fact melanosomes — organelles within cells that contain melanin, the pigment that gives colors to hair, feathers, skin, and eyes.

Calculating Your Superconductor

I’ve wondered and dreamed about this for years.  The Materials Project doesn’t test new materials – it calculates them.

To date [The Materials Project] has calculated the basic set of properties for more than 58,000 compounds, says lead developer of The Materials Project Anubhav Jain, who is based at the Lawrence Berkeley National Laboratory – a lot of stuff, but only a start to the vision of sourcing new materials at a few key strokes.

(Leigh Phillips, NewScientist, 26 September 2015, paywall)

Definitely a site for professionals, not passive readers like me – but it looks fascinating not only as a repository of results, but …

It has also recently launched an app that allows anyone to dream up a compound and submit it to Jain for computation. Another enables you to input the qualities you desire and then uses machine learning to suggest compounds that fit. These tools are designed so that anyone can begin with a handful of atoms and a rough idea of a material they want to make and begin generating ideas for compounds. Personal jetpack, anyone?

For a materials scientist tired of throwing atoms at a wall and hoping they stick, this has to be the dream come to reality.  Apparently a genomic computation approach is used, as simulating reality in every detail is well beyond the capabilities of today’s computers – certain simplifications are made and this, I presume, forces some hunting about for materials with given properties in certain conditions.

Along with enjoying the idea of calculating what you need, rather than slopping about in a lab, I also found this bit interesting:

[The Materials Project] s part of a much wider Materials Genome Initiative coordinated by the US federal government. Just about every US research outfit and government agency with an interest in science is involved, from Harvard University to the Department of Defense to NASA. Since 2011, $250 million has flowed into the scheme, much of it spent on powerful computers that will “support U.S. institutions in the effort to discover, manufacture, and deploy advanced materials twice as fast, at a fraction of the cost”.

You’re Digitized at 1/3mm

… but your mate, he’s a bit blurry: only at 1mm.  If you want a digital recreation of real people, they’re now available.  The best?  Of a woman who died two decades ago, as NewScientist‘s Jessica Hamzelou reports (26 September 2015, paywall):

Now the woman’s body has been recreated, in far greater detail. She has been digitised at a much higher resolution, thanks to the thinner slices used. The male cadaver was sectioned at 1 millimetre intervals; the woman at intervals of just a third of a millimetre. …

Their phantom is the most detailed digital reconstruction of a whole human body ever to be pieced together. She has 231 tissue parts, ranging from windpipe to eyeballs, but is missing nose cartilage and 14 other bits of the body.

How useful is it?

“They have ten times as much information as you’d get from an MRI scan,” says Fernando Bello, who develops simulations for medical procedures at Imperial College London. “It means the team will have much more information about organs and their structuring.”

The high resolution of the model makes it ideal for virtual experiments. Each of the woman’s tissues has a well-defined set of parameters, such as density and thermal conductivity. This makes it possible to compute the impact that radiation, for example, and various imaging techniques are likely to have on living tissues.

“The phantom gives us a great opportunity to study human tissues without having to do human studies, which are lengthy and expensive,” says Ara Nazarian, an orthopaedic surgeon at Harvard Medical School who is collaborating with Makarov.

Makarov’s team has already started running tests that are too risky to try on living people. In one, they gave their model a metal hip or femur, and studied the effect of putting it in an MRI scanner. Metal implants heat up in the scanner’s strong magnetic field, and little is known at present about how best to scan people who have them.

And this data is publicly available here from the U.S. National Library of Medicine.  From their data page:

The dataset from the female cadaver has the same characteristics as the male cadaver with one exception. The axial anatomical images were obtained at 0.33 mm intervals instead of 1.0 mm intervals. This results in over 5,000 anatomical images. The female dataset is about 40 gigabytes in size. Spacing in the “Z” direction was reduced to 0.33 mm in order to match the pixel spacing in the “XY” plane which is 0.33 mm. This enables developers who are interested in three-dimensional reconstructions to work with cubic voxels.

Coal Digestion, Ctd

Fossil fuels run into some more headwinds, reports Sami Grover @ TreeHugger.com:

The latest to join the club is ANZ, one of Australia’s big four banks, which The Guardian reports is making a bold commitment to stop funding any new conventional coal-fired power plants that don’t deploy Carbon Capture and Storage and/or similar technologies that significantly reduce carbon emissions.

Additionally, ANZ is pledging $10 billion over the next 5 years to fund renewable energy, reforestation, energy efficiency and other low emission technologies.

This is a promising sign indeed. And it may be driven as much by economics as it is ethics. Indeed, ANZ acknowledged in a statement that its exposure to carbon intensive industries was considered by many to be an increasingly significant financial risk, and that the bank needed to play its part in helping to manage an “orderly transition” from fossil fuels: …

Banks are, supposedly, experts at evaluating risk.  When the business evaluation of the situation calls for moving away from fossil fuels, I think we can expect faster and faster movement towards the renewable sources of energy.

Sami’s source is this the guardian article.  It includes this statement:

But ANZ said it was committed to the internationally agreed target of limiting global warming to 2C above pre-industrial times. The bank said it would transparently report its progress on climate and set targets to reduce its own emissions.

Australia three other largest banks – Westpac, Commonwealth Bank and NAB – are all signed up to sustainability commitments for their lending. But environmental groups have pressed them to do more by ruling out investment in coal projects, as overseas banks have done with Adani’s huge Carmichael mine in Queensland.

I’ll be interested in knowing how ANZ defines “transparently.”  Done properly and it can become an excellent example for other companies to follow, or not, depending on outcomes.

I wonder if the accession of Mr. Turnbull to the Prime Ministership pressured ANZ into making this commitment.  the guardian article also notes this about Australia’s situation:

According to University College London, 90% of Australia’s known coal reserves must be left unburned to keep the world on track to avoid warming above 2C. Analysis released by AGL last year showed that 75% of Australia’s ageing coal-fired power stations were operating beyond their “useful life” but that it was too expensive to shut them down.

Elephants Point the Way to Good Government, Ctd

For those curious about the campaign against ivory poaching, news from the Elephant Action League indicates some progress in the problematic nation of Tanzania:

“The Queen of Ivory”, a Chinese national, arrested by a specialized Task Force in Tanzania. To date, she is the most important ivory trafficker ever arrested in the country.

Dar-es-Salaam, 8 October 2015 – A specialized wildlife trafficking unit under Tanzania’s National and Transnational Serious Crimes Investigation Unit (NTSCIU) arrested a number of high-level Chinese ivory traffickers led by a woman who is now thought to be the most notorious ivory trafficker brought to task so far in the war against elephant poaching. She is believed to be behind the trafficking of a huge quantity of ivory over the last several years.

The woman, now dubbed the “Queen of Ivory”, is a Chinese national named Yang Feng Glan, 66, and has been followed by the Task Force for over a year. She recently disappeared from Tanzania, moving to Uganda, but returned one week ago, when the Task Force swiftly moved and arrested her. After confessing to many of her crimes she has been taken to the high court of Dar es Salaam facing a maximum sentence of 20-30 years imprisonment.

Race 2016: Donald Trump, Ctd

In case you’re a Trump supporter because you like small, unintrusive government, Ilya Somin @ The Volokh Conspiracy takes apart Trump’s view of the government capability of takings.

In a recent interview with Fox News, Donald Trump, who has a history of abusing eminent domain for his own benefit, claims that the condemnation of property for transfer to private developers is “a wonderful thing” and “is not taking property”:

So eminent domain, when it comes to jobs, roads, the public good, I think it’s a wonderful thing, I’ll be honest with you. And remember, you’re not taking property, you know, the way you asked the question, the way other people—you’re paying a fortune for that property. Those people can move two blocks away into a much nicer house.

When the government forces you to give up your land against your will, that is pretty obviously a “taking” of property. That’s true as a legal matter, and it is also true as a matter of simple common sense.

It is true that victims of eminent domain get compensated by the government. But Trump’s claim that they get “a fortune” and can then “go buy a house now that’s five times bigger, in a better location” is, in the vast majority of cases, simply false. If it were true, people would be happy to have their homes condemned. It also isn’t true that victims of takings can usually just “move two blocks away into a much nicer house.” Since World War II, urban renewal takings and other condemnations for private development have forcibly displaced hundreds of thousands of people, most of whom were left far worse off than they were before.

Coal Digestion, Ctd

BloombergBusiness‘ Tom Randall points out that renewables may now be unstoppable:

To appreciate what’s going on [in the USA], you need to understand the capacity factor. That’s the percentage of a power plant’s maximum potential that’s actually achieved over time.

Consider a solar project. The sun doesn’t shine at night and, even during the day, varies in brightness with the weather and the seasons. So a project that can crank out 100 megawatt hours of electricity during the sunniest part of the day might produce just 20 percent of that when averaged out over a year. That gives it a 20 percent capacity factor.

One of the major strengths of fossil fuel power plants is that they can command very high and predictable capacity factors. The average U.S. natural gas plant, for example, might produce about 70 percent of its potential (falling short of 100 percent because of seasonal demand and maintenance). But that’s what’s changing, and it’s a big deal.

For the first time, widespread adoption of renewables is effectively lowering the capacity factor for fossil fuels. That’s because once a solar or wind project is built, the marginal cost of the electricity it produces is pretty much zero—free electricity—while coal and gas plants require more fuel for every new watt produced. If you’re a power company with a choice, you choose the free stuff every time.

It’s a self-reinforcing cycle. As more renewables are installed, coal and natural gas plants are used less. As coal and gas are used less, the cost of using them to generate electricity goes up. As the cost of coal and gas power rises, more renewables will be installed.

The important business question?

Historically, a high capacity factor has been a fixed input in the cost calculation. But now anyone contemplating a billion-dollar power plant with an anticipated lifespan of decades must consider the possibility that as time goes on, the plant will be used less than when its doors first open.

The Weather is Good

… at least according to the Rosetta Probe:

The Rosetta space probe has spotted a square-kilometre field of solid ice in the neck region of comet 67P/Churyumov-Gerasimenko. The comet’s day-night cycle drives its small weather system using the ice field, sublimating the ice into vapour when the sun rises.

The ice was spotted in data gathered last August using Rosetta’s VIRTIS instrument – a spectrometer designed to map the comet’s chemical composition. The water signal was stronger when the neck was in shadow and weaker during the comet’s day.
